You are on page 1of 2

Karakteristina pitanja za usmeni ispit

Algoritmi:
1. Nacrtati strukturni dijagram toka algoritma koji niz A sa N elemenata ureuje u neopadajui
redosled nekom od metoda. Nabrojati metode za sortiranje nizova.
2. Dijagramom toka grafiki predstaviti for i repeat-until tipove petlji pomou while petlje.
3. ta je odredjeno tipom podatka?
4. Navesti: a) linearne strukture podatka, b) nelinearne strukture podataka.
5. Napisati i objasniti sintaksu deklaracije jednodimenzionalnih polja. Navesti primer inicijalizacije
niza prilikom deklaracije.
6. Navesti i objasniti linearne strukture podatka.

Programiranje:
1. Navesti namene identifikatora u programskom jeziku C i pravila za sintaksno ispravno formiranje
identifikatora.
2. Objasni format unosa naredbe scanf.
3. Strukture. Navesti primer strukture koja opisuje kompleksne brojeve.
4. Prenos parametara po vrednosti i referenci.
5. Navesti dva naina kako je sadraj jednog stringa mogue kopirati u drugi string?
6. Koje od navedenih rei mogu biti identifikatori u programskom jeziku C?
7. ta su identifikatori programskog jezika? Koje pravilo vai za imenovanje identifikatora u
programskom jeziku C?
8. Definisati makro za izraunavanje razlike dva zadata broja i dati primer korienja u C-u.
9. Objasniti operator ++ i nain upotrebe ovog operatora.
10. Navesti potrebne linije koda da bi u programu bilo mogue koristiti funkcije: printf, sin, cos, abs i
strcmp.
11. ta su stringovi? Objasniti i napisati primer deklaracije stringa
12. Funkcija za itanje podataka iz tekstualnog fajla. Objasniti parametre
13. Definisati makro za mnoenje dva broja i dati primer korienja u C-u.
14. Objasniti unije u C-u.
15. Objasniti prenos parametra funkciji po vrednosti i po referenci i navesti kratke primere koji
ilustruju upotrebu.
16. Na koji nain je sadraj jednog stringa mogue dodeliti drugim stringu? Navesti primer.
17. Navesti funkcije za otvaranje i zatvaranje fajlova, objasniti ulogu, nain upotrebe i parametre.
18. Napisati funkciju u C-u za ciklinu zamenu vrednosti tri promenljive A1, A2 i A3.
19. Definisati makro za nalaenje manjeg od dva broja i dati primer korienja u C-u.
20. Napisati program na C-u koji poredi sadraj dva stringai rezultat poreenja prikazuje na ekranu.
Stringove uneti sa tastature.
21. Objasniti dejstvo i parametre funkcije fopen.

22. Pobrojati faze u razvoju C programa po redosledu obavljanja.


23. Koji su parametri funkcije main() u programskom jeziku C i koje je njihovo znaenje?
24. Objasniti ulogu pojedinane izlazne konverzije ija je sintaksa %[-][+|
][#][w[.d]][h|l|L]<tip_konverzije> i objasniti ta e biti prikazano nakon izvrenja naredbe
printf("%f8.3",x).
25. Objasniti ulogu preprocesorskih direktiva #include i #define.
26. Funkcija strcmp: dejstvo funkcije, deklaracija i parametri funkcije.
27. Napisati funkciju za sabiranje dva cela broja. U glavnom programu uneti dva broja sa tastature i
sabrati ih korienjem napisane funkcije. Objasniti stvarne i fiktivne parametre na napisanom
primeru.
28. Uloga funkcija fopen, fclose, feof, fgets i fprintf.
29. Objasniti ulogu pojedinane ulazne konverzije ija je sintaksa %[w][h|l|L]<tip_konverzije>
30. Napisati i objasniti sintaksu deklaracije jednodimenzionalnih polja. Navesti primer inicijalizacije
niza prilikom deklaracije.
31. Objasniti funkciju strstr: dejstvo funkcije, deklaracija funkcije, parametri, kratak primer koji
ilustruje upotrebu. Koji se rezultat dobija nakon izvrenja navedenog primera?
32. Napisati kratak, kompletan primer programa u C-u u kome se otvara proizvoljan tekstualni fajl,
upisuje jedan celobrojni podatak i odmah nakon toga zatvara fajl. Podatak koji se upisuje
inicijalizovati prilikom deklaracije (ne unositi sa tastature).
33. Pojedinana ulazna konverzija, upotreba, sintaksa.
34. Navesti kratak, ali kompletan primer programa u C-u u kome se otvara proizvoljan fajl, ita jedan
celobrojni podatak funkcijom fscanf i odmah nakon toga zatvara fajl.
35. Objasniti mehanizam dinamikog zauzimanja i oslobaanja memorije u C-u
36. Deklaracija stringova u C-u i inicijalizacija prilikom deklaracije. ta oznaava pojam
nullterminated string?

You might also like